Sharpsburg council to meet in special session Saturday, April 9

Sharpsburg Council will conduct a special public meeting Saturday night to address several issues, one of which involves the hiring of an interim borough manager in a closed-door session instead of a public vote.

Council last month introduced former Crescent Township administrator Jason Dailey as the temporary replacement of former manager Bill Rossey, who left the job mid-March.

However, there was never a formal vote at a public session to hire Dailey, which is a possible violation of the state’s Sunshine Act, which requires council votes to be conducted in open session before the public.

According to the special meeting agenda posted on the borough’s website, council will “consider the contract for professional interim management services” during the meeting scheduled for 7 p.m. Saturday, April 9 at borough offices, 1611 Main St. The meeting is open to the public.

Other items listed on the special meeting announcement for action include a memorandum of understanding for the Allegheny Shores development, as well as a grant application for roadway infrastructure of the development.
